WebInstead of allowing you to stroke your knife smoothly, high-viscosity oils will get in the way. This will take away the effectiveness of your stone. And you may end up with an improperly sharpened knife. Another reason you want to avoid high-viscosity oils is due to their stains. A lot of heavy oils will leave these when you remove them. WebJun 23, 2024 · To hone a knife, you'll need a honing steel, which resembles a long screwdriver with a soft pointed edge. At a 15 to 20 degree angle, hone the knife against the steel. Be careful — honing at a higher angle can permanently damage the blade. When it comes to sharpening knives, many recommend leaving it up to the professionals.

From this position, run the knife along … high speed sheet metal laser cutter machineWebPlastic, rubber, and natural stone (1) Plastic, rubber, tungsten carbide, and ceramic (1) Silicon Carbide (1) Solid tanned leather (1) Stainless Steel, Plastic, Diamond (1) Stainless steel (1) Steel blank with nickel … how many days off for bereavementWebApr 7, 2024 · Place the blade of the knife against the stone, with the edge of the dull knife facing down. Use your dominant hand to hold the handle of the knife, and use your other hand to hold the blade steady against the stone. Apply pressure to the blade and move it back and forth across the stone in a smooth and controlled motion. high speed shimmy
